How to get an accurate garage door quote
The more you can tell us up front, the closer the first number will be to the final one — and the fewer trips it takes to get there. Useful things to include:
- Rough opening size — width and height of the hole in the wall, not the door.
- Headroom — how much space there is between the top of the opening and the ceiling or the steel above it.
- What is there now, if anything, and whether it needs removing and hauling away.
- Whether the garage is attached to the house or heated, which changes whether insulation is worth paying for.
- A photo or two. Honestly the single most useful thing you can send. One of the opening from outside, one from inside showing the tracks and the ceiling.
If you do not know some of that, send the form anyway. It is our job to work it out, not yours.
Worth knowing before you compare any quotes, ours included: the Oregon Construction Contractors Board recommends getting more than one bid, checking that whoever you hire is licensed and bonded, and making sure the written agreement names the licence number and the materials. Their consumer tools set out what a good contract looks like.

What happens next
Your message comes straight to the office in Eugene, and somebody who knows the answer reads it — it does not go into a ticketing system in another state.
For most jobs the next step is a short conversation to fill in whatever the form could not, and then either a price or a visit. Repairs usually need somebody to look at the door; straightforward door replacements can often be quoted from photographs and measurements.
If your door is stuck, jammed, or has a broken spring and you cannot get a vehicle in or out, please ring rather than write. Springs in particular are not something to experiment with — there is more on that in our repairs and maintenance page.

Questions people ask before getting in touch
How much does a new garage door cost?
It depends on size, construction, material and glass. A standard insulated steel door for a two-car garage sits in a very different place from a full-view glass or real timber door. Send us the details and we will price it properly rather than guess.
Can I just send photos?
Please do. Photographs of the opening from outside and from inside, plus rough measurements, let us get much closer to a real number before anybody drives anywhere.
